In this insightful podcast episode, Dr. Rohm explores the dangers of the four most perilous words in the English language: "I already know that." This know-it-all attitude not only stifles personal growth but also hinders one's ability to learn from others. By admitting that we don't know everything, we open ourselves up to a world of possibilities and endless learning opportunities.

Dr. Robert A. Rohm is a well-known speaker, author, and expert in the fields of communication, leadership, and personality assessment. He is the founder of Personality Insights, Inc., a company that provides resources and training programs to help individuals and organizations improve communication and build positive relationships. Dr. Rohm has authored several books, including "Positive Personality Profiles" and "Taking Flight!: Master the DISC Styles to Transform Your Career, Your Relationships, Your Life". He is also a sought-after speaker and has conducted training sessions and seminars for businesses, schools, and organizations across the world.
